State by State: ASEAN and Minnesota Trade

by

Minnesota’s almost billion-dollar trade surplus with ASEAN is impressive; in 2014, Minnesota’s exports of US$1.77 billion far exceeded imports from the region of US$808.4 million. ASEAN received 8.3% of the state’s total exports in that year.

Indonesia Gives Tax Breaks to Exporting Manufacturers

by

Indonesia has brought in tax breaks for enterprises exporting a minimum of 30 percent of their production, in line with tax breaks for multinationals re-investing profits in-country rather than sending profits and dividends to overseas shareholders.

Indonesia’s Economy Struggles to find its Footing

by

For the second quarter in a row, Indonesia’s economy contracted as exports and government spending continued to decline – GDP was down 0.18 percent. The country’s currency, the rupiah, also fell.
